The Hengst 1055830B (1055830B) is a high-performance hydraulic inline filter designed for the effective filtration of solids from fluids in hydraulic and lubricating oil systems. This robust filter is intended for installation in pipelines and features a durable construction with nodular cast iron and carbon steel housing. It utilizes a multilayer glass fiber material, designated as PWR3, providing a filtration grade of 3 to ensure optimal cleanliness of the fluid. The filter is part of the 250LE series and includes an NBR seal, offering reliable sealing capabilities under various conditions. With a nominal size of 0400, this inline filter supports a maximum working pressure of up to 280 bar and has a nominal pressure rating of 250 bar. It is equipped with an optical indicator to monitor the condition of the filter element, allowing for timely maintenance and ensuring continuous system protection. The design includes a bypass cracking pressure set at 7.0 bar and features horizontal port positioning meeting SAE standards with dimensions of 1 7/8-12 UN-2B. The Hengst inline filter also incorporates advanced features such as cyclone effect technology to enhance filtration efficiency and reduce maintenance intervals. It is suitable for use with HFC/HFA fluids and complies with DIN24550 standards, making it versatile for various applications. The absence of a check valve simplifies its integration into existing systems without compromising performance or reliability.
